Somerville’s annual Water System Flushing Program continues today, Monday, June 1st, and continues through late October.
This program consists of flushing pipes at high velocities to clean water mains and maintain the highest possible water quality.
Temporary drops in water pressure and/or discolored water can occur. In these cases, though the water may be discolored, it is safe to drink. Until the water runs clear, it is advisable to avoid washing laundry, especially white fabrics.
